Balakliia is a small Ukrainian town in Kharkiv Oblast, set among the rolling countryside of eastern Ukraine. Its streets reflect years of history, from Soviet-era architecture to cozy family-run cafes. The town serves as a gateway to rural Kharkiv region, with easy access to forests, rivers, and farmland.

Visitors can expect a friendly, down-to-earth atmosphere and plenty of opportunities to sample traditional Ukrainian cuisine.

Culinary Guide

Food in Balakliia

Ukrainian cuisine here emphasizes hearty comfort foods made with local produce and dairy, with plenty of seasonal vegetables and breads.

Balakliia Famous Food

Signature dishes, delicacies and famous food

Borscht (Beet Soup)

A hearty beet soup often served hot with sour cream and rye bread.

Must-Try!

Varenyky (Pierogi)

Dumplings filled with potato and cheese or mushrooms, boiled or pan-fried.

Deruny

Crispy potato pancakes typically served with sour cream.

Holubtsi

Stuffed cabbage rolls with rice and meat, usually served with tomato sauce.

Climate Guide

Weather

The region experiences a continental climate with warm summers and cold winters. Expect hot, sunny days in summer and chilly, sometimes snowy conditions in winter. Spring and autumn are mild with variable rain and wind; pack layers year-round.

How to Behave

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ior

Greeting

A firm handshake is common; use polite forms such as 'pan' (sir) or 'pani' (madam) when addressing elders or strangers.

Dress and etiquette

Dress modestly for religious sites; remove hats indoors as a sign of respect.

Photography

Ask permission before photographing people; be respectful of private properties and religious spaces.

Safety Guide

Safety

Travelers should stay aware of their surroundings, keep valuables secure, and follow local authorities and travel advisories. Use reputable accommodations, avoid isolated areas at night, and carry emergency numbers: 101 (fire), 102 (police), 103 (ambulance). Have traveler insurance and a local contact if possible.

Tipping in Balakliia

Ensure a smooth experience

Tipping Etiquette

In Ukraine, consider a tip of 5-10% in restaurants if service is not included; round up at casual cafes.

Payment Methods

Cash is widely accepted; cards are common at larger venues; smaller shops may prefer cash or mobile payments.

Dietary Restrictions

Tips for restricted diets.

Vegetarian

In Balakliia, vegetarians can enjoy beet soup (borscht) without meat, dumplings with potato or mushroom fillings (varenkyky), deruny, holubtsi without meat, and fresh salads. Ask for dishes prepared without meat stock or lard, and confirm cheese is made with vegetarian rennet.

Health & Medical

Healthcare

Basic healthcare is available in town through local clinics; for more advanced care, regional hospitals in Kharkiv city or larger centers are available. Carry essential medications and travel insurance; bring proof of prescription if needed. In emergencies, call local emergency numbers (101, 102, 103).
